Getting from Alexandroupoli to Agistri

If you are heading to Agistri from Alexandroupoli you are making your way from the far northeastern corner of Greece to a small pine-covered island in the Saronic Gulf, on the opposite side of the country. It is almost entirely covered in forest with good beaches and clear water close to Athens.

 

Take the ferry

There is no direct ferry from Alexandroupoli to Agistri. Alexandroupoli's ferry connections are limited to Samothrace, Lemnos, Agios Efstratios and Lavrio. Getting to Agistri by sea means flying to Athens first and then taking the Saronic ferry from Piraeus to Agistri, which takes around 55 minutes to 1 hour 35 minutes with up to 15 daily departures in summer.

 

Getting there by air

Agistri has no airport. The nearest airport is Athens. Flying from Alexandroupoli to Athens and then taking the Saronic ferry from Piraeus to Agistri gives a total journey time of around 3 to 4 hours.

 

Your best option

Fly from Alexandroupoli to Athens and take the Saronic ferry from Piraeus to Agistri. With up to 15 daily departures in summer you never need to book the Piraeus to Agistri connection in advance. If you are traveling with a car, drive from Alexandroupoli to Piraeus via the Egnatia motorway and E75, which takes around 8 to 9 hours, and then take the conventional ferry across to Agistri.
